RAWALPINDI: Four persons died on Monday when lightning hit them in Arifwala and Kahuta near Rawalpindi, ARY News reported.

A wet spell running through Punjab and Khyber Pakhtunkhwa provinces. Sporadic rainfall in Rawalpindi, Peshawar and other areas have turned weather pleasant providing relief to the people suffering from the heat of scorching summer.

The lightning claimed two lives in Arifwala in Punjab during heavy rainfall.

In another incident, two persons belonging to Kahuta while travelling on a motorbike, sought shelter under a tree due to heavy rain.

Unfortunately lightning struck them killing both of them on the spot.

The bodies were shifted to local hospital where relatives identified them.
